I am a Research Fellow and Co-Investigator at the University of Sheffield (2024âPresent), following my previous role as a Postdoctoral Research Associate at the same institution. My academic background includes BEng and MEng degrees in Chemical Engineering and a PhD completed as a Grantham Scholar, all awarded by the University of Sheffield. My primary research interests include biobased polymers, horticulture, and controlled environment agriculture (CEA). As co-lead of the CEA cluster at the Institute for Sustainable Food, I coordinate interdisciplinary research into future farming systems. My current work centers on the BBSRC-funded "WHyGrow-in-Me" project, where I develop biobased adhesives to bind waste materials together into sustainable, hybrid growing media, with the goal of directly addressing the peat crisis in UK horticulture.

Summary of Research Project(s)
WHyGrow-in-Me (BBSRC): As Co-Investigator on this £1.66M grant, I am leading the development of waste-based hybrid growing media for Protected and Controlled Environment (PACE) horticulture by utilizing bio-based polyurethane binders and biowaste fillers.
Disease Suppressive Microbes (BBSRC Bacterial Plant Diseases Programme): Working as a Research Associate, I designed and optimized synthetic polyurethane foams for hydroponic systems. These substrates were engineered to limit the growth of bacterial plant pathogens while integrating beneficial microbes to enhance crop resilience.
Healthy Soil, Healthy Food, Healthy People (H3 Consortium): I contributed to the Hybrid Hydroponic Horticulture work package within this UKRI-funded project, researching how novel foam-based growing media and synthetic microbiomes can be combined to transform the sustainability and production capacity of UK agriculture.
Recycled Polyurethane for Green Infrastructure (Innovate UK KTP): Serving as Deputy Knowledge Base Supervisor on a £280K Knowledge Transfer Partnership with The Vita Group, I successfully translated academic polymer research into commercial prototypes, focusing on recycling polyurethane foam into functional substrates for green roofs and walls.
